36 Fordhouse Lane is a late Victorian / early Edwardian freehold semi detached house with 3 bedrooms with scope to modernise and refurbish.

The setting is convenient within 200 yards or so of the Pershore Road with buses and other facilities.  There is good access to surrounding areas and important centres within a radius of 2 miles or so include Birmingham University, Kings Norton Business Centre, Queen Elizabeth Hospital and Cadburys / Kraft at Bournville.

The building is of brickwork with a double glazed bay window at ground floor level. It is set back from the road behind a compact garden and the accommodation is on 2 floors and comprises:-

Enclosed Porch entered via a traditional style door with window above.  From here a door opens into the

Entrance Hall with stairs leading off and door into the:- 

Rear Living Room 
12'1 x 11'10 (3.68m x 3.61m) with radiator, double glazed window, door to the dining kitchen and a wide opening to:- 

Front Living Room 13'7 into bay x 11'10 (4.14m x 3.61m) with radiator and double glazed bay window.

Dining Kitchen 
14'2 x 9'3 (4.32m x 2.82m) with range of surfaces, inset sink with double glazed window above, base cupboards and wall units, spaces for appliances, tiling and doors to the garden and to

Rear Lobby / Utility with spaces for appliances and door to 

Bathroom 6'9 x 6'5 ( 2.06m x 1.96m) with bath with shower above, basin, wc, radiator, tiling and double glazed window.

UPSTAIRS

Landing with doors to all the bedrooms.  A hatch opens to The Loft.

Bedroom 1 15'2 x 12' (4.62m x 3.66m) with radiator and two double glazed windows at the front.

Bedroom 12'3 x 9'1 (3.73m x 2.77m) with radiator and double glazed window overlooking the garden.

Bedroom 3 14'4 overall x 9'7 (4.37m x 2.92m) with radiator and double glazed window at rear.

OUTSIDE

A gate and path on the right hand side of the house leads to the The Private Garden which paved area next to the house with lawn beyond.
